Gastritis is one of the common digestive disorders in adolescents, which is influenced by unhealthy lifestyles such as irregular eating habits, fast food consumption, lack of knowledge, and stress. This study aims to determine the effect of health education using booklet media on the level of gastritis prevention behavior in adolescents at MTS Thoriqul Huda Mojowarno Jombang. The research design used was pre-experimental with a one group pre-test and post-test approach. The research sample consisted of 69 respondents, this study used a probability technique with proportional random sampling. The instrument used was a questionnaire compiled based on indicators of gastritis prevention behavior. Data analysis was carried out using the Wilcoxon Signed Rank Test. Before the pre-test, the results showed that most 68.1% of respondents were categorized as sufficient, and after the post-test, the results showed that most 63.8% of respondents were categorized as good. The results showed a significant increase between the level of gastritis prevention behavior before and after being given health education through booklet media, with a p value of 0.000 <0.05. The conclusion of this study is that providing health education using booklet media is effective in improving gastritis prevention behavior in adolescents
